The Aarushi Talwar Murde Case , also known as the 2008 Noida Double Murder Case , remains one of India’s most sensational and controversial unsolved mysteries.  The Incident On the morning of May 16, 2008, 13-year-old Aarushi Talwar was found dead in her bedroom in Noida with her throat slit and head bludgeoned. Initially, the family’s missing domestic help, Hemraj Banjade, was the prime suspect. However, his body was discovered on the terrace of the same building the next day, killed in a similar manner.  Key Investigative Developments Initial Investigation : The Noida Police were heavily criticised for a botched investigation, including failing to secure the crime scene and allowing it to be contaminated. The "Honour Killing" Theory: Police initially alleged that Aarushi’s parents, Rajesh and Nupur Talwar, killed her and Hemraj after finding them in an "objectionable" position. The Sheena Bora Murder Case  is one of India's most high-profile criminal investigations, involving a complex web of family secrets, financial disputes, and a three-year cover-up.  The Disappearance (2012) Missing Date: Sheena Bora, a 24-year-old executive at Mumbai Metro One , went missing on April 24, 2012 . The Deception : Her mother, Indrani Mukerjea (then CEO of INX Media ), had introduced Sheena to everyone as her younger sister. After Sheena disappeared, Indrani told friends and family—including Sheena’s fiancĂ© and step-brother Rahul Mukerjea —that Sheena had moved to the United States for studies. No Report : No missing person's complaint was filed by the family at the time.  The Murder & Cover-up The Act : According to the CBI , on the evening of April 24, 2012, Sheena was picked up in a car by Indrani Mukerjea , her ex-husband Sanjeev Khanna , and their driver Shyamvar Rai . Aluva Athul (real name Atul , aged 30) was a notorious gangster from Oachira who was hacked to death in broad daylight on March 14, 2026 , in Karunagappally, Kollam.   The Incident Location & Time: The attack occurred around 11:00 AM on a busy stretch of the National Highway near Puthiyakavu , Karunagappally . The Ambush : Athul was returning from the Karunagappally Police Station after fulfilling a mandatory bail condition to sign the attendance register. The Attack : A gang in a Haryana-registered Innova chased and intentionally rammed his blue Swift car, forcing it into a ditch dug for flyover construction. The assailants then smashed the car windows and brutally hacked Athul with machetes and iron rods. Outcome : Athul sustained fatal injuries to his head and legs and was declared dead upon arrival at a nearby hospital. Jack the Ripper is the pseudonym of an unidentified serial killer who murdered at least five women—known as the "canonical five"—in the Whitechapel district of London between August and November 1888 . The case remains one of history's most famous unsolved mysteries, characterised by gruesome post-mortem mutilations and taunting letters sent to the police.  The Canonical Five Victims While the wider Whitechapel Murders file includes 11 victims from 1888 to 1891, five are widely accepted as the work of the same killer due to their similar and increasingly severe injuries:  Mary Ann Nichols : Found August 31, 1888, in Buck's Row. Annie Chapman : Found September 8, 1888, in the backyard of 29 Hanbury Street. Elizabeth Stride: Found September 30, 1888, in Dutfield's Yard (the first of the "Double Event").
